On January 2, 2023, millions watched in shock as Buffalo Bills safety Damar Hamlin suddenly collapsed in cardiac arrest during a widely televised NFL playoff game. During a tackle, a blow to his chest caused his heart to stop, and he stopped breathing. For many, this was their first exposure to what sudden cardiac arrest (SCA) looks like, and in the days and weeks that followed, the nation learned just how critical immediate hands-only CPR and a shock from an automated external defibrillator (AED) are to an SCA victim’s survival.
Fortunately, with dozens of trained responders on the field and an established cardiac emergency response plan in place, Hamlin’s life was saved. However, every young athlete deserves the same chance for survival, and the disparity in preparedness across the nation is staggering.
Just months later after an outpouring of demand for better SCA prevention protocol, the NFL along with major sports organizations and leading health advocacy groups announced the formation of the Smart Heart Sports Coalition to advocate for all 50 states to adopt evidence-based policies that will prevent fatal outcomes from SCA among high school students.
Best practices include:
- Emergency Action Plans (EAPs) that include cardiac emergency response preparedness for each high school athletic venue that are widely distributed, posted, rehearsed, and updated annually;
- Clearly marked automated external defibrillator (AEDs) at each athletic venue or within 1-3 minutes of each venue where high school practices or competitions are held; and,
- CPR and AED training for coaches.
SCA Facts
Over 23,000 youth under age 18 suffer out-of-hospital cardiac arrest each year
75% of fatalities in sports are cardiovascular-related
Less than 10% of SCA victims survive
89% of SCA victims could be saved with immediate CPR and AED use
